Terrifying, I need some advice!!!! please help.
« on: March 25, 2013, 01:50:05 pm »
2 days ago i went to 24hour fitness to workout. When i was working on my biceps.The pad was torn a small part(already been there for long time) where i put my arm.When i put my arm on the pad, it was hurt a little bit but i didnt notice it until i get home 2 hours later. I saw a red mark like a dot on my left elbow(which i put on the torn part). Is there any chance that i was poked by a needle with hiv blood of sb else hidden in there. If so, am i infected?? :'(. Is there any symptom i should notice ????

Re: Terrifying, I need some advice!!!! please help.
« Reply #1 on: March 25, 2013, 02:04:14 pm »
Hi Bats . HIV is a fragile, difficult to transmit virus that is primarily transmitted INSIDE the human body, as in unprotected anal or vaginal intercourse where the virus never leaves the confines of the two bodies.

Once outside the body, small changes in temperature, and pH and moisture levels all quickly damage the virus and render it unable to infect.

Its beyond paranoid to think that a person would hide a needle or syringe in hopes of infecting someone . In order for that to happen it would have be fresh blood and then 
the syringe would have to be depressed to make an injection , all of which is ridiculous and something you would have noticed . I'm HIV positive , if I stuck myself with a pin and you took that pin and stuck your self with it , it still wouldn't be infectious because of it being exposed to air and the pH changes .

You do not need to worry about getting exposed to HIV in the manner you described .
